Lambing Flat Chinese Tribute Gardens - Enjoy a relaxing wander through the gardens and enjoy the 'Pool of Tranquility'. The gardens located at Chinaman's Dam look spectacular all year round. The development of the gardens began in 1992 and was established to recognise the contribution of the Chinese community to the settlement of Young in the 1860s, and to the ongoing contributions of the Chinese community to Australia as a Nation. Informative heritage signs provide information on the establishment of the gardens and the dam.

Did you know:
Why is it called Cherrypicking? The term is based on the perceived process of harvesting fruit, such as cherries. The picker would be expected to select only the ripest and healthiest fruits. An observer who sees only the selected fruit may thus wrongly conclude that most, or even all, of the tree's fruit is in a likewise good condition.
